Evaluating The Name “jack”

The name “Jack” has a rich history and its origins can be traced back to various cultures. In English, it is derived from the name “John” and was often used as a nickname. Its meaning is commonly associated with attributes such as “God is gracious” and “gift of God”.

In popular culture, the name “Jack” has garnered a positive perception. It is often portrayed as a strong and dependable character, imbued with qualities such as bravery and resourcefulness. These qualities have made the name popular in literature, movies, and television shows, further contributing to its favorable image.

The versatility of the name “Jack” is another factor that adds to its appeal. It can be used as a standalone name or as a diminutive for other names like “Jackson” or “Jacob”. This flexibility allows individuals to tailor it to their preferences, while still benefiting from the name’s positive associations.
